A Blinkit delivery agent is seen on the road in Kolkata, India, on January 14, 2026. Major delivery aggregators agree to remove the 10-minute delivery service deadline following the government's intervention. Government sources say a meeting with leading platforms, including Blinkit, Zepto, Zomato, and Swiggy, is held to address concerns related to delivery timelines. The move aims to ensure greater safety, security, and improved working conditions for gig workers.

In Krakow, Poland, on December 30, 2025, police attend a farmers' protest against the EU-Mercosur agreement. Across the country, farmers stage protests aimed at blocking roads and disrupting traffic, with demonstrations reported in more than 171 towns and cities. The farmers oppose the planned agreement between the European Union and Mercosur countries (including Argentina, Brazil, Uruguay, and Paraguay), arguing that it floods the European market with South American food products that do not meet EU quality standards. As a result, these cheaper imports push higher-priced, better-quality European food off the market and drive local farmers into crisis. In Krakow, farmers use tractors to slow traffic and block crossings at pedestrian lanes in front of the Voivodeship Office.
